What is the difference between Manufacturing Associate vs Production Technician?
| Aspect | Manufacturing Associate | Production Technician |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| High school diploma or equivalent; some roles may require certifications | High school diploma; technical certifications may be preferred |
| Work Environment | Factories, production lines, manufacturing plants | Factories, production areas, equipment operation |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Manufacturing companies, assembly plants | Manufacturing, industrial facilities, production units |
| Common Search & Comparison | Yes | Yes |
Manufacturing Associates and Production Technicians both work in manufacturing environments, often performing similar tasks such as assembling products, operating machinery, and ensuring quality. The main differences lie in certifications and technical skills; Production Technicians typically require more technical training or certifications and may handle more complex equipment. Both roles are essential in the manufacturing industry and often overlap in daily responsibilities.
What is a manufacturing associate?
A manufacturing associate assists in the operations of a manufacturing facility and the products that it produces. As a manufacturing associate, your job duties include organizing supplies and raw materials inventory, preparing equipment, and training staff with preparation and production. You may also investigate the manufacturing process to fix any issues and ensure it meets strict regulations. The qualifications for a career as a manufacturing associate typically include a bachelor’s degree and prior manufacturing experience in a similar industry. You also need computer proficiency, as the job may require daily use of multiple software applications, along with mechanical skills to handle a variety of manufacturing tools and equipment.

Senior Manufacturing Associate II (Principal Biotechnologist) - Large-Scale Allogeneic Cell Therapy
Location: Portsmouth, NH, USA.
Schedule: Day Shift, 7:00 AM - 7:00 PM, Rotational 2-2-3 Pattern. Weekend shifts include additional shift differential pay.
Operational Timeline Note: This role supports our brand-new, state-of-the-art Large Scale Allogeneic manufacturing facility. The team is currently gearing up to launch initial facility water runs in July, with routine clinical and commercial production ramping up shortly thereafter.
We are seeking a highly skilled technical leader to join our team in Portsmouth, NH, as a Senior Manufacturing Associate II (Principal Biotechnologist). This advanced, floor-based role is responsible for acting as a shop-floor Subject Matter Expert (SME) and leadership anchor during the critical start-up and scaling phases of our brand-new Large Scale Allogeneic asset. Operating under general supervision, you will lead complex, automated unit operations, spearhead operational readiness activities, and manage technical workflows across distinct cleanroom zones. This is an upstream-focused manufacturing role utilizing single-use bioreactor technologies.

What you'll do:
Upstream Process Lead: Assume the shop-floor lead role during core upstream manufacturing operations, specifically managing single-use bioreactor systems, cell growth, culture maintenance, and product harvest activities.
Hybrid Gowning Execution: Comfortably balance processing environments by dedicating approximately 25% of your time to Grade B gowning, executing critical, high-stakes aseptic processing techniques to start the campaign, while spending the remaining 75% of operations in a Grade C cleanroom setting.
Facility Launch Support: Provide hands-on operational support during the facility's initial engineering runs, training runs, and technical transfer water runs scheduled to kick off this July.
Documentation & EBR Optimization: Author, review, and execute critical cGMP documentation, with a strong focus on generating, troubleshooting, and optimizing Electronic Batch Records (EBR),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), and Work Instructions (WIs).
Staff Training & Mentorship: Arrange, coordinate, and deliver effective hands-on training to manufacturing staff regarding new large-scale automated equipment, single-use single systems, and facility quality structures.
Quality & Deviation Ownership: Maintain absolute adherence to cGMP and Data Integrity policies, leading minor floor investigations, identifying process bottlenecks, and initiating change controls or CAPAs.
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with the shift supervisor, customer SMEs, and Manufacturing Project Specialists to introduce operational improvements and track production milestones effectively.
What we're looking for:
Experience: 5-10 years of advanced experience within a cGMP biological or cell therapy manufacturing environment is required. Prior specialized experience in upstream processing (bioreactor inoculation, harvest, single-use systems) is a highly desired plus but not explicitly required.
Technical Mastery: Strong working knowledge of cleanroom classifications, aseptic processing techniques, and electronic quality documentation platforms (such as TrackWise).
Leadership Traits: Proven ability to direct day-to-day work tasks on the floor, troubleshoot technical processing errors under tight timelines, and maintain high standards of accountability within a matrixed team.
Education: High School Diploma or equivalent is required; an Associate's or Bachelor's Degree in a science or engineering discipline is preferred.
Physical Requirements: Ability to comfortably stand for extended periods, undergo continuous sterile gowning protocols (Grade B and Grade C), perform precise fine-motor manipulations, and occasionally lift up to 50 lbs.
